National grid suffers second collapse in January 2026

Nigeria’s national electricity grid collapsed on Tuesday morning, the second time in January 2026.

The first grid failure of the year happened last Friday.

The Nigeria National Grid verified the latest breakdown on X at 10:53 a.m.

The post simply read: “Grid Collapse.”

A follow-up tweet said, “Restoration is in progress!”

Power generation has fallen to zero megawatts, according to numbers obtained from the Nigerian Independent System Operator, NISO.

The affected distribution firms include Ikeja, Jos, Kaduna, Kano, Benin, Eko, Enugu, Port Harcourt, Ibadan, Abuja and Yola.
